buizen

"Buizen" means "tubing" or "to fail exams" in English, depending on the context.


Plural noun, referring to hollow cylinders used for transporting fluids or gases.

De loodgieter bevestigde de nieuwe buizen onder de gootsteen.

The plumber installed the new pipes under the sink.


Verb, informal usage meaning to fail or not pass.

Als ik blijf falen, zal ik dit jaar buizen voor mijn examens.

If I keep failing, I will flunk my exams this year.


Plural noun, indicating objects with a hollow and cylindrical shape.

De kinderen speelden met lege buizen en deden alsof ze trompetten waren.

The children played with empty tubes pretending they were trumpets.
